The Art of Marble Care: Polishing vs. Restoration

Understanding the difference between polishing and restoration can help you extend the life and beauty of your marble surfaces. While polishing enhances the shine and smoothness of the stone, restoration goes deeper, repairing scratches, etches, and damage to bring the marble back to its original condition.

Polishing is ideal for routine maintenance, keeping your marble looking fresh and vibrant without altering its structure. It removes minor imperfections and creates a protective layer that makes the surface easier to clean and maintain.

Restoration, on the other hand, is necessary when the marble has suffered significant wear or damage. It involves professional techniques to grind, hone, and reseal the surface, reviving both its appearance and durability. Knowing when to polish versus when to restore ensures your marble remains elegant and long-lasting.
